1. Shift networking from transactions to relationships
- Reconnect with two people per month with a short, value‑adding message.
- Share one thing you learned about an AI feature and ask one simple question in return.
- Offer a small help (review a draft, share a prompt) when someone asks.
2. Use “learn in public” micro‑content
- Post a short example of how you used an AI tool (a 30‑second video, a screenshot of a Copilot prompt and the cleaned output).
- Ask a closed question in your post (“Anyone optimize Copilot prompts for meeting recaps?”).
- Accept quick feedback — these posts often produce concise, high‑value tips and templates.
3. Create and join peer study groups
- Form a 4–6 person weekly check‑in for a month focused on one tool (e.g., Copilot for Outlook).
- Rotate short demos — 10 minutes each — so everyone both teaches and learns.
- Keep sessions practical: show prompts, share pitfalls, and maintain a shared notes doc.

What employers and managers should do to enable networked learning
Employers carry the primary responsibility to reduce learner friction. Policy, tooling, and culture can be tuned to let networks flourish.- Create safe spaces for failure. Employees should be encouraged to share mistakes and low‑stakes experiments without penalty.
- Support peer communities. Provide micro‑learning resources, shared prompt libraries, and time for peer cohorts.
- Formalize AI champions. Empower cross‑functional champions who can facilitate show‑and‑tell sessions and build a troubleshooting network.
- Include governance and privacy training. Ensure employees know how to handle proprietary data with AI tools; set clear rules of the road.
Strengths of the “networked learning” approach
- Speed and relevance: Learning from peers is immediate and directly c.
- Low cost: Informal check‑ins and micro‑demos cost far less than full training runs.
- Trust and psychological safety: Advice from someone who shares your job context is easier to apply and less threatening.
- Scalability through social proof: As a few employees demonstrate wins, adoption cascades faster across a team than through centralized mandates.
